Welcome to on-call for the Glimmerpane design system! Our snapshot tests live in the `snapcheck` suite and run on every merge to main. If a UI component changes visually, the diff bot flags it — usually it's an intentional tweak, so just approve the new baseline. If it's 2am and snapshots are failing across the board, it's almost always a font-loading race, not your problem. To unlock the baseline store and re-approve snapshots in bulk, use the recovery passphrase below.

recovery phrase for tahag-taguf: wenix-caswyn

## The Goods Lift

Quick heads-up: the big lift at the back of Wrenfield House is reserved for deliveries only — please steer couriers that way rather than letting them wheel trolleys through the main lobby. It runs from the loading dock straight up to each floor's service corridor, which keeps the carpets (and everyone's shins) safe. Passenger use is a no-no except when facilities says otherwise. The lift call panel at the dock is locked with a keypad, and the code is:

door code, yagap-bahof: bdg-O-05

## Provenance: Localized date formats in Thistledown plugins

Plugin authors targeting the Thistledown platform must not hardcode date patterns. The host resolves locale at render time, and provenance checks compare your declared locale bundle against the manifest shipped in the build. Mismatched bundles fail attestation silently in older runtimes, so test against at least one non-Gregorian locale. Each published plugin build embeds its locale manifest hash, and reviewers verify it against the provenance token below.

trace token, kahog-tajeg: htk6_97d963